Wyoming Statutes
§ 26-18-129 — Third-party ownership
"Insured", as used in this chapter, shall not be construed as
preventing a person, other than the insured, with a proper
insurable interest from making application for and owning a
policy covering the insured or from being entitled under that
policy to any indemnities, benefits and rights provided therein.
